Associate Director Of Strategic Planning & Execution For Us Medical Affairs
Are you ready to make a significant impact in the world of rare diseases? As the Associate Director of Strategic Planning & Execution for US Medical Affairs, you will drive strategic initiatives and collaborate with Therapeutic Area (TA) Leadership teams to align projects with our overarching goals. Your role will involve analyzing, resolving, and communicating key strategic programs, enabling informed decision-making that contributes to our success. With your project management expertise, you'll ensure projects are delivered on time, within scope, and on budget.
Responsibilities
Strategic Partnership :
- Develop annual enterprise strategy for assigned TA and / or Function and ensure effective, efficient, and equitable delivery of key strategic programs and operational activities
- Oversight of business progress against performance targets through outcomes and metrics tracking / reporting
- Highlight and communicate US Medical impact and effectiveness throughout all levels of the organization
- Proactively apply business acumen to ensure business continuity and identify future opportunities
Financial Reporting :
